What problem does it solve?

Visual design cohesion across Zero-Day Attack interfaces is often inconsistent; this guide consolidates color palettes, SVG styling rules, and rendering conventions to ensure a unified look and predictable behavior.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Centralized color system including palette, path colors, and tile/grid colors to enable consistent design across UI and assets.
  • SVG and token design standards to streamline asset production for tiles and tokens, and to support accessibility guidelines.
  • Use Case: Designers and developers reference this guide when updating or creating visuals to maintain brand consistency.
